What do you put on freshly peeled skin?

Moisturizer or lotion can be applied to freshly peeled skin to prevent dryness and promote healing.

Detailed response

After peeling the skin, it is important to take care of it by applying a moisturizer or lotion to prevent dryness and promote healing. According to dermatologist Dr. Michele Green, “Moisturizing after peeling can help to soothe any irritation that may occur and help build the skin’s protective barrier.”

Here is a table of common ingredients found in moisturizers and their benefits for freshly peeled skin:

Ingredient Benefits
Aloe Vera Soothes and reduces inflammation
Vitamin E Speeds up healing process
Tea tree oil Anti-inflammatory and antibacterial properties
Hyaluronic acid Hydrates and plumps skin
Ceramides Restores skin barrier
Shea butter Nourishing and moisturizing

What should I put on my skin after it peels?
Proper post-peel skin care

  1. Wash your face with cool water. Warm or hot water might not feel as good as cool or cold water, which can help soothe post-peel sensations.
  2. Moisturize and hydrate.
  3. Apply sunscreen with SPF30 or more.
  4. Avoid strenuous workouts, dry saunas and steam rooms.
  5. Don’t over-exfoliate.

What should I do if I get a Peel?
Moisturize and hydrate. Since peels can temporarily compromise your skin’s protective barrier, it’s important to reinforce that barrier with a medium-to-thick moisturizer. Also, drink more water to help avoid dehydration, which could make your skin feel tight. Apply sunscreen with SPF30 or more.
How do I Stop my Skin from peeling after a sunburn?
Answer will be: Take a cool (just below lukewarm) bath. This can help ease the pain of your sunburn and stop your skin from peeling further. Avoid showering if your skin is blistered in addition to peeling, as showering may pop your blisters and trigger more peeling. Do not use soaps or bath oils when you bathe. These can make your peeling worse. 4.

Should you let peeling skin slough off naturally?
As a response to this: You should let peeling skin slough off naturally. The peeling is part of your skin’s natural healing process. Picking at or pulling off peeling skin can create an opening that lets in bacteria. This increases your risk of infection. Apply fragrance-free, hypoallergenic moisturizing cream or ointment (they’re thicker than lotions).
